The singer, who has been vocal about his mental health struggles, said that how from the time he was a teen, he was constantly reminded of how great he was, something Bieber credited to his downward spiral.
You hear these things enough as a young boy and you actually start believing it," he shared. The ' I Don't Care ' singer said that the fame was also detrimental to his personal growth, as he never learned the true meaning of responsibility and was never able to develop any skills beyond his music career. By this point, I was 18 with no skills in the real world, with millions of dollars and access to whatever I wanted," he explained.
By 20, I made every bad decision you could have thought of and went from one of the most loved and adored people in the world to the most ridiculed, judged, and hated person in the world," Bieber continued. Despite the problems he faced, Bieber said he found comfort and support in a group of friends, including his wife Hailey Baldwin, who "encourage him to keep going. It's taken me years to bounce back from all of these terrible decisions, fix broken relationships, and change relationship habits," he admitted.
